UD Las Palmas is placed in 13th spot (22 points, 5W – 7D – 6L) in the Spanish Segunda. They have had an amazing start of the season, not only amazing but incredible. The Club built a team to fight for avoiding the relegation and maybe that measure is the real one, but the team was playing in superb mode until 4 weeks ago. They are a mixture between solid veterans and fresh youngsters. Paco Jemez (UD Las Palmas’ coach) has been able to manage the secret potion and the Canary team is playing quite well. They are quite aggressive at home and they are usually playing an appealing offensive style, scoring goals and enjoying in front of their home crowd.
UD Las Palmas has shown to be a quite dangerous team playing on counter-attack style. They have fast and dynamic players who do a quick and passing game style very effective.
